With this motherboard, AOpen provides a very special, useful feature for overclockers. When you
power-on the system, the BIOS will check last system
POST
status. If it succeeded, the BIOS will
enable “Watch Dog ABS” function immediately, and set the CPU
FSB
frequency by user’s setting
that stored in the BIOS. If system failed in BIOS POST, the “Watch Dog ABS” will reset the system
to reboot in five seconds. Then, BIOS will detect the CPU’s default frequency and POST again. With this special feature, you can easily
overclock your system to get higher system performance, and without removing the cover of system housing to set the jumper to clear
CMOS data when your system hanged.
